// Gating rules for Pondwick canary deploys. Short version: we
// won't promote past 5% traffic unless error rate stays under
// baseline for two full windows AND latency p99 behaves. Yes,
// it's conservative — we got burned last quarter. Tweak the
// thresholds below only with release-manager sign-off, and note
// the approving build via the token below.

pipeline stamp: htk4_c337

## 3.9.1 — Key rotation (InkPress PDF invoice renderer)

We rotated the signing key used to stamp rendered invoices after the scheduled quarterly audit flagged the old key as nearing expiry. Invoices generated before this release remain valid; no customer action needed. Support: if a merchant reports a signature-verification warning, confirm they're on renderer 3.9.1 or later. All new invoice batches are now signed with the key below.

rollout seal: bky3_bf1

# Break-Glass: Catalog Cache Invalidation

Scope: the Pinrow product catalog at Veldstone Retail. If stale prices persist after a purge and the Hollowmere invalidation queue is wedged, use break-glass to flush the edge tier directly. Contractors: get verbal sign-off from the catalog lead first. Steps: open the Hollowmere admin shell, select emergency-flush, confirm the tenant, and run it once — repeated flushes thrash the origin. Access is logged and expires after 20 minutes. Unseal the admin shell with the passphrase below.

recovery phrase for kahop-tajog: istix-casvan

# Returned Demo Units — Dispatch Procedure

Demo units coming back from the Alderbrook showroom must be checked against the loan register, wiped by the Bramwell bench team, and repacked in foam-lined cases before release. Returns go out only via Norwick Freightways, Tuesdays and Thursdays. Once the driver signs the return manifest, the dispatch clerk states the following instruction:

dispatch memo: the lamwyn fenwyn courier leaves the wenir ledger at gate 7175 under passcode 822969

## Changelog — Glintworks Components v5.0.0

This major release renames all `Gl`-prefixed components to unprefixed names and drops support for the legacy theming API. A codemod is provided under tools/migrate-v5. Please read MIGRATION.md fully before upgrading, as the changes are not backward compatible. Questions about the versioning decisions in this release should go to the release owner.

named custodian: Oliath Ralax